Output fdd9c69a59801629e7ea59203f115a7cdbc7a7d6bfcbf6476a37a382fdc9b42d:0

value
26539337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79f752ee2722f72a148523ec9c78e455c63e02e6 OP_EQUAL
address
3Couy8ANz2q8KdEZVMjthxErCsDU5bVumP
transaction
fdd9c69a59801629e7ea59203f115a7cdbc7a7d6bfcbf6476a37a382fdc9b42d
confirmations
317551
spent
true